Page 2
· Test · Reset · Automatic charge 2. Do not change the original positions of the quadruple dip switch S inside CoolMasterNet when using it with VRV/VRF systems. WEEE Directive & Product Disposal At the end of its serviceable life, this product should not be treated as household or general waste.
CoolMasterNet PRM Rev 0.7 Layout 3 Layout 1. USB Host, HVAC Line L8 2. Power 3. Power Plug 4. RS232 Port 5. HVAC Line L1 6. HVAC Line L2 7. HVAC Line L3 or RS485 Port 8. Ethernet Port 9. GPIO 10.
· requirements. · Lines L1 and L5 share the same internal resources of CoolMasterNet and can not be used simultaneously. · Lines L2 and L6 share the same internal resources of CoolMasterNet and can not be used simultaneously. DIP Switch P3 defines which line is enabled.
1,4,6,7,8 Not Connected Gender and pinouts of the RS232 cable supplied with CoolMasterNet are suitable for connection to PC RS232 port directly or via standard RS232 to USB adapter. Maximal length of the RS232 Cable should not exceed 25m. By default RS232 Interface is dedicated for ASCII I/F.
Aserver can be configured with command. 4.4.2 ModBus IP 4.5 RS485 By default Line L3 is used as an RS485 Interface line for DTE connection. CoolMasterNet supports the following RS485 based protocols: · ModBus RTU (Slave mode) 4.5.1 ModBus RTU...
Rev 0.7 Connections 4.5.3 CoolGate 5 CoolMasterNet can be used as a ModBus RTU slave device working in accordance with Modbus-IDA.ORG "MODBUS over serial line specification and implementation guide". RS485 default frame format is (can be changed with line baud...
If the write request started from one of the reserved registers the response will be illegal data address. 4.6 GPIO CoolMasterNet supports four GPIO marked as A B C D (see Layout ). GPIO can be in Input or Output mode...
Control of the GPIO functionality is done with g p i o command. 4.7 USB CoolMasterNet incorporate USB Device and USB Host ports. USB Device port is used for maintenance operations. 4.8 Power CoolMasterNet can be powered from different power sources: ·...
CoolMasterNet PRM Rev 0.7 DIP Switches 5 DIP Switches DIP Switches are located behind the small access door at the upper right side of the CoolMasterNet. DIP Switch P Switch P1,P2 Link L6,L7 and enable polarity auto-detection on Separate L6,L7...
CoolMasterNet PRM Rev 0.7 DIP Switches Notes: · If all four Dip Switches R1, R2, R3, R4 are in ON position during CoolMasterNet power reset, CoolMasterNet will be forced to enter BOOT Mode. Dip Switch S Switch S1,S2 Enable DC Output on HVAC Line L1...
ASCII I/F 6 ASCII I/F CoolMasterNet provides a simple and comprehensive ASCII I/F Protocol, based on text (ASCII) strings, representing verbal commands and responses . ASCII I/F implemented in CoolMasterNet is fully backward compatible with previous versions of CoolAutomation products, but has a number of significant extensions and improvements mainly aimed to support additional CoolMasterNet functionality.
CoolMasterNet PRM Rev 0.7 ASCII I/F Virtual Address In Use Virtual address already in use Bad Property Wrong property Number of lines exceeded Can't define more line types Warning! Dip Switch State Incorrect Dip swith state is incorrect for defined line type...
To change setting use format with <SETTING> and <VALUE>. Some settings are read only (RO) and can not be changed. defaults will load default values to all settings <SETTING> Mode Printed as Value* Description CoolMasterNet Serial Number X.Y.Z version version CoolMasterNet Firmware Version application string CoolMasterNet Application baud baud rate 1200...115200...
+/-flr, +/-vam, +/-io (see example) myid string CoolMasterNet Own address on given HVAC Line. For ModBus RTU Line myID is a "Slave Device Address" baud Configure UART parameters for given Line. Value format is: Where applicable <BAUD>...
(DHCP client) or fixed IP number. In case of DHCP - Netmask and Gateway values are provided by DHCP server. By default CoolMasterNet is configured for DHCP client operation. CoolMasterNet Ethernet module can be enabled or disabled with corresponding command.
<GA> <func> <direction> <UID> - Create new KNX group, i.e. link KNX group · address <GA> with CoolMasterNet function and UID. <GA> can be in the form of Main/Mid/Sub or Main/Sub, direction: < - CoolMasterNet input, > - CoolMasterNet output. group dellall ·...
Create KNX group: link 10/0/1 with L1.100 as CoolMasterNet Mode input >knx group 10/0/1 M < L1.100 Create KNX group: link 10/0/1 with L1.100 as CoolMasterNet Room Temperature output >knx group 10/0/1 RT > L1.100 List KNX group for group address 10/0/1 >knx group 10/0/1...
CoolMasterNet PRM Rev 0.7 ASCII I/F >knx group -2 props SYNOPSIS props props <UID_STRICT> <PROPERTY> <VAL> DESCRIPTION Query or change Indoor Unit(s) properties. In format without parameters props command will list all stored properties in comfortable table. <PROPERTY> Mode Value...
R link <UID1_STRICT><=|~><UID2_STRICT> DESCRIPTION Control link operation in CoolMasterNet. Linking ThermoPad on CoolHub line with Indoor Unit will grant the ThermoPad full control over the Unit. · In format without parameters l i n k will list existing links ·...
HVAC status and control configuration command to CoolPlug device connected to CoolHub line. CoolPlug device will be recognized by CoolMasterNet as Indoor Unit with UID. Refer to CoolPlug PRM for list of compatible commands. EXAMPLE Send command to CoolPlug device 080 on CoolMasterNet line L3 >plug L3.080 set...
DESCRIPTION Simulate <CNT> Indoor Units on HVAC Line <Ln>. If <Ln> is omitted the first not "Unused" HVAC Line will be taken. Simulation is not persistent and CoolMasterNet reset will terminate it. EXAMPLE Simulate 5 Indoor Units on HVAC Line L2 >simul L2 5...
CoolMasterNet PRM Rev 0.7 ASCII I/F gpio norm <A|B|C|D> <c|C|o|O> DESCRIPTION Query or configure GPIO functionality. GPIO configurations are persistent (over power reset) and take effect only after reboot. · Without parameters g p i o command provides information about current GPIO configuration in the below format: >gpio...
DIP switch can't be read DCOUT enable command was given to CoolMasterNet DCOUT disable or no command at all was given to CoolMasterNet No voltage detected on the line 16 volt detected on the line (own or external) Line DC...
CoolMasterNet PRM Rev 0.7 ASCII I/F response will be illegal data address. EXAMPLE List current ModBus configuration >modbus ModBus IP : disabled server port : 502 CG4 ignore : none Enable ignore setting >modbus ignore r Lisk current ModBus configuration >modbus...
CoolMasterNet PRM Rev 0.7 ASCII I/F main lock group SYNOPSIS on [UID] DESCRIPTION Turn on Indoor Unit(s). EXAMPLE Turn on Indoor Unit 102 on line L1 >on L1.102 Turn on all Indoor Units on Line L2 >on L2* Turn on all Indoor Units >on...
CoolMasterNet PRM Rev 0.7 ASCII I/F alloff SYNOPSIS a l l o f f DESCRIPTION Turn off all Indoor Units. cool SYNOPSIS cool [UID] DESCRIPTION Set Indoor Unit(s) operation mode to cool. EXAMPLE Set Indoor Unit 102 on line L1 to cool mode >cool L1.102...
CoolMasterNet PRM Rev 0.7 ASCII I/F SYNOPSIS [UID] DESCRIPTION Set Indoor Unit(s) operation mode to fan. EXAMPLE Set Indoor Unit 102 on line L1 to fan mode >fan L1.102 Set all Indoor Units on line L2 to fan mode >fan L2* Set all Indoor Units to fan mode >fan...
CoolMasterNet PRM Rev 0.7 ASCII I/F >auto L2* Set all Indoor Units to auto mode >auto haux SYNOPSIS haux [UID] DESCRIPTION Set ThermoPad(s), connected to CoolHub line, operation mode to haux. EXAMPLE Set ThermoPad 083 on line L3 to haux mode >haux L3.083...
CoolMasterNet PRM Rev 0.7 ASCII I/F 0.5ºC 0.5ºC 1ºC 1ºC MD,CG,KT,TR 1ºC 1ºC 1ºC The deg setting (see command) defines which temperature scale Celsius or Fahrenheit is used for <TEMP> and <TEMP.d> parameters value. EXAMPLE Set Indoor Unit 102 on line L1 Set Temperature to 23º...
[UID] DESCRIPTION Get Indoor Unit(s) status list. If UID is omitted all Indoor Units connected to CoolMasterNet will be listed. Indoor Unit status line has strict format, so that every status field is printed in fixed position. · Indoor Unit status line with Celsius temperature scale 0123456789012345678901234567890123456 L2.102 OFF 20C 27C High Cool OK...
Same as ls, but with decimal precision in temperatures. Get Indoor Unit(s) status list. If UID is omitted all Indoor Units connected to CoolMasterNet will be listed. Indoor Unit status line has strict format, so that every status field is printed in fixed position.
CoolMasterNet PRM Rev 0.7 ASCII I/F Unit in form Ln.XYY or XYY. Resulting value is printed as alpha-numeric value according to the table below. Query Operation Condition Value On/Off 0 - Off, 1 - On Operation Mode 0 - Cool...
[±]<TEMP[.d]> DESCRIPTION This command defines CoolMasterNet Own Ambient Temperature (as if it were measured by CoolMasterNet itself). Command can work in relative or absolute manner. If plus '+' or minus '-' sign precedes <TEMP> parameter it's value will be added to or substituted from current value. Otherwise Own Ambient Temperature will be set to the given <TEMP>...
CoolMasterNet PRM Rev 0.7 ASCII I/F ON/OFF control of the Water Heater Unit is performed with regular o f f commands. EXAMPLE Set Hot Mode on Water Heater Unit 101 on Line L1 >wh L1.101 w Set Altherma Unit 000 on Line L4 Tank Set Temperature to 40º...
CoolMasterNet PRM Rev 0.7 ASCII I/F L1.300 - L1.301 + L1.302 - L2.100 ? L2.101 ? L2.102 ? L2.103 ? Unset main RC: Indoor Unit 206 on line L2 >main L2.206 0 Set new main RC: Indoor Unit 201 on line L2 >main L2.201 1...
DESCRIPTION Most of the HVAC systems have an prohibit/lock/inhibit functionality to prevent user from changing Indoor Unit settings via wired or remote Local Controller. Same functionality is provided by CoolMasterNet with l o c k command. · l o c k Query locks for specific Indoor Unit.
R DESCRIPTION Control group operation in CoolMasterNet. Grouping of two Indoor Units means that second Indoor Unit will follow ON/OFF, Mode, Fan Speed, Set Temperature and Swing settings of the first Indoor Unit. · In format without parameters group will list existing groups ·...
· In format without parameters va command will list all VA associations and their ModBus addresses in hexadecimal and decimal format. · va auto - CoolMasterNet will automatically associate VA's with existing (visible with command) UID's. This will delete previous associations ·...
CoolMasterNet PRM Rev 0.7 ASCII I/F L2.104 --> 006 [Hex: 0x0061 | Dec: 0097] Delete all VA associations of Indoor Unit 100 on line L1 >va - L1.100 Delete VA association number 4 >va - 4 Delete all VA associations >va delall...
Need help?
Do you have a question about the CoolMasterNet and is the answer not in the manual?
Questions and answers